首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在cookie React fetch中存储JWT标记

在React中使用cookie来存储JWT标记可以提供更好的用户体验和安全性。下面是一个完善且全面的答案:

JWT(JSON Web Token)是一种用于在网络应用间传递信息的安全方式。在React中,可以使用cookie来存储JWT标记。Cookie是存储在用户浏览器中的小型文本文件,可以在客户端和服务器之间传递数据。使用cookie存储JWT标记可以确保用户在登录后在应用的不同页面之间保持登录状态。

下面是一些步骤来实现在cookie中存储JWT标记:

  1. 首先,安装相关依赖。在React项目中,可以使用js-cookie库来操作cookie。在终端中运行以下命令进行安装:
  2. 首先,安装相关依赖。在React项目中,可以使用js-cookie库来操作cookie。在终端中运行以下命令进行安装:
  3. 导入并设置cookie。在需要使用JWT标记的组件中,导入js-cookie库,并将JWT标记存储在cookie中。可以使用以下代码示例:
  4. 导入并设置cookie。在需要使用JWT标记的组件中,导入js-cookie库,并将JWT标记存储在cookie中。可以使用以下代码示例:
  5. 在上述代码中,将JWT标记存储在名为jwtToken的cookie中。请将YOUR_JWT_TOKEN替换为实际的JWT标记。
  6. 获取和使用JWT标记。在其他需要验证用户身份的组件中,可以使用以下代码示例来获取并使用JWT标记:
  7. 获取和使用JWT标记。在其他需要验证用户身份的组件中,可以使用以下代码示例来获取并使用JWT标记:
  8. 在上述代码中,首先使用Cookies.get方法获取存储在cookie中的JWT标记。然后,可以将JWT标记添加到请求头的Authorization字段中,并使用fetch函数发送带有JWT标记的请求。

以上是如何在cookie React fetch中存储JWT标记的完善且全面的答案。

腾讯云相关产品和产品介绍链接地址:

请注意,以上链接为腾讯云相关产品的介绍页面,仅供参考。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券